DESCRIPTION
Welcome to apartment E11F  is a junior one bedroom with almost 686 square feet and a living/dining room the size of a large one- bedroom apartment. The sleeping room is separated from the main living area and boasts two large closets and can accommodate a queen size bed and tons of natural light. The light colored herringbone floors are in excellent condition and the windows are large and very soundproof. The kitchen is open to the living room and has updated appliances. There is a marble bathroom with full tub. The apartment is filled with light and is a happy place to call home.

A unique feature at The Gotham is a laundry room with two washers and two dryers on each floor almost across the hall from E11F-so convenient.

UPPER EAST SIDE

The Upper East Side has a reputation of wealth and opulence. Once home to the wealthiest New Yorkers (like the Kennedys, the Roosevelts, and the Rockefellers), the UES is filled with ornate and beautiful buildings. Today, the Upper East Side is still considered one of the more expensive neighborhoods, however, in recent years, it has begun to see younger arrivals (people in their 20s and 30s) who are finding better deals up north, away from the Lower East Side and/or hip Williamsburg.

With the completion of the 2nd Avenue train, the neighborhood is only becoming more accessible to everyone as previously the only train servicing the UEW was the 4,5,6 on Lexington Avenue. Even better, the further east you go, the cheaper the apartments get. All this is only adding on to the interest from renters who no longer have to commute for as long to get to the area.
